HP WallArt Wordpress Plugin error

#1 Hixster 7 years ago

Hi, I've attached a screenshot below of an error I'm having difficulty fixing. I've integrated the HP WallArt WordPress and woocommerce plugins (seemingly successfuly) such that the HP WallArt designer populates the customer's e-commerce basket. However, the basket always shows the attached error. Namely: "Warning: Missing argument 3 for ... hpwallart.php on line 202" (see attached) Examing the hpwallart.php file the function on line 202 takes three arguments, with the third being $cart_item_key. Please could you help me identify why this argument isn't being picked up (or set) or identify why the error is occurring? I've searched for a resolution online but there's scant information available. Your help would be appreciated. We're nearly there with the site! Thank you and regards, Chris
